			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A photograph can have a thousand meanings. These meanings are all dependent on who is currently viewing the picture. The photographer usually has another view of the picture because he has seen the area outside of the photograph and there could be other reasons for taking the picture. The value of a photograph also depends on what the reason is for taking the picture.</p>
<p><strong>Personal Value</strong></p>
<p>A camera is something that most people own. Not all photographers are professional photographers, most are just your day to day individuals who have cameras and wish to take pictures for posterity and memories. A photograph can be something quite randomly taken yet has a deep meaning for the photographer due to the subject in the picture. On the other hand, a photograph taken professionally can seem to have several meanings and yet it was taken subjectively for the express purpose of profit and art, not for memories.</p>
<p>One can still find a photograph taken for personal value in a photo gallery due mainly to several factors. These factors include the subject and the photographer. A picture can become famous because it has someone or something famous in it as the subject or because the photographer is someone famous. These two factors are some of the main reasons why there are still so many photographs that sell for several thousands.</p>
<p><strong>Aesthetic Value</strong></p>
<p>The aesthetic value of a photograph can be the reason why many people like to view it and buy it. Sometimes, the photographer can catch a certain emotion in the photograph which can convey itself to the viewers. It is this art of bringing a picture to life that can actually attract buyers and viewers.</p>
<p>Some clients ask the professional photographer to take pictures of certain people, things and scenes, and then choose from the shots taken. This is one of the advantages of pictures; there can be a variety of pictures from which the client will choose from. A photograph can mean anything to any person, which is why it is best to have several on hand especially when hired to take shots of an individual person, thing or scene.</p>
<p>Taking a photograph is so easy when you think about it but professionals always take into consideration several factors that can actually make the picture more vocal. The reason for taking an emotive photograph is to reach the people looking at it. The photographer can actually be skilled enough to portray his emotions and thought into a single picture.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A pet photographer certainly has things cut out for him. Basically, one defines pets as animals which have been domesticated enough to be bale to live with man as companions. Not all animals are for suitable pets but this does not stop people from buying and acquiring these kinds of animals. A pet photographer is quite unusual for the fact that although, there are many people who think highly of their pets, these people do not have their pets portraits done professionally.</p>
<p>Not all pet photographers are actually professionals. Some are just hobbyists who like to take pictures of their pets. These people are most likely to have the average point and shoot digital cameras compared to the professionals who have the more expensive kinds of cameras. For those who are just starting to appreciate just how beautiful a pet can be here are some tips for taking pictures of them and be a better pet photographer.</p>
<p><strong>Natural Light And Surroundings</strong></p>
<p>A pet photographer would get more action from his pets if they are not self conscious or wary about the area they are in. Bringing the pet or pets to an unfamiliar place may take them several minutes to relax and do its antics. In the meantime, it is also best to avoid too many pets incase there is a disagreement. Pet owners should be present during the photo session to be able to handle and control the pets for the pet photographer.</p>
<p>The use of natural light should be one of the things that a pet photographer should utilize. This is because the fur on most pets tends to look better with natural light. The natural light can also bring out the different hues or shades of the animal&#8217;s fur in the photograph.</p>
<p><strong>Be Casual And Comfortable</strong></p>
<p>Pets are often aware of the emotions of their owners. Therefore, pet owners who want to try out being a pet photographer should opt for a slow but sure photo session instead of forcing the pet into positions or poses. The more excited or agitated the owner gets, the pet will also have its own reaction. When the pet photographer in you decides to make an appearance, it is best to go about in your pet&#8217;s natural home or area.</p>
<p><strong>Experiment With Your Camera And Poses</strong></p>
<p>One thing that many experts recommend for pet photographers is to use macro lenses when taking portrait shot of your pet. These will bring out the grains and individual strand of hair in your portrait making it more expressive and clear. You might also like to try out the different features of your camera to be bale to fully utilize it.</p>
<p>As a pet photographer, you must always be patient enough to see when the pet has had enough and when it is no longer interested in posing for you.</p>
